'This book is made up of five short stories. • Home Brew tells the tale of a man who turns his life around while caring for his grandmother. • Golf is about the fulfilment of a dream to make a living out of golf and finally hitting the 'Big Time'. • The Gamble is centred around gambling, greyhound and horse racing and a guy who finds himself through opportunity. • Rock 'n' Roll follows the life of an Australian band on the road along with sex, drugs and the high life. • Heading Down to New Orleans is a recollection of the author's travels in the USA.' (Publication summary)
